  • Publication number: 20210382080
    Abstract: With an analyzer capable of carrying out a plurality of kinds of analyses, the device is suppressed from being increased in size. The analyzer includes a first measurement unit for holding a cuvette to which a biological sample is dispensed, and performing a first measurement of a content of the cuvette; a second measurement unit for holding a cuvette, and performing a second measurement different from the first measurement of the content of the cuvette; and a transport unit for gripping the cuvette, and transporting the cuvette to an attachment and detachment position of the first measurement unit or an attachment and detachment position of the second measurement unit. The transport unit moves along a guide rail, and the attachment and detachment position of the first measurement unit and the attachment and detachment position of the second measurement unit are provided on a line substantially along the guide rail.

  • Publication number: 20160018426
    Abstract: To efficiently prevent a decrease in measurement accuracy caused by a change in a test cartridge and an environmental temperature, provided is an automatic analysis device. The automatic analysis device includes: a constant-temperature reservoir (6) to be heated by a heating source (6a) so as to keep a liquid temperature at least in the reaction cell (11c) of the test cartridge (10) in the test stage (KT) at a constant environmental temperature set previously; constant-temperature reservoir control means (7) including a temperature detector (7a), for controlling a set temperature of the heating source (6a) of the constant-temperature reservoir (6) so that the set temperature of the heating source (6a) is higher when the internal environmental temperature is lower than a previously-determined threshold value than when the internal environmental temperature is equal to or higher than the threshold value, based on the internal environmental temperature detected by the temperature detector (7a).
